LEACH-RMC:一种异构传感网的节能簇头路由算法

0 下载量 189 浏览量 更新于2024-09-01 收藏 501KB PDF 举报
"异构传感网基于圆环域的簇头混合通信路由算法,LEACH-RMC,节能,网络生存期,簇头负载均衡" 在无线传感网中,节能是至关重要的,因为节点通常由有限的电池电源供电,并且在特殊环境中无法轻易更换。LEACH(Low-Energy Adaptive Clustering Hierarchy)协议是早期提出的一种节能策略,通过周期性地随机选择簇头来分散网络的能量负担。然而,LEACH在处理异构传感网时存在簇头能耗不均衡的问题,导致网络寿命缩短。 针对这一问题,LEACH-RMC(LEACH-Based Ring Domain Cluster Head Hybrid Communication Routing Algorithm)算法被提出。此算法创新性地采用了基于圆环域的簇头分级策略,将监测区域划分为多个圆环,每个圆环内的节点竞争成为相应等级的簇头。这种分级方式使得离基站较近的节点更有可能成为低级别的簇头,而离基站较远的节点则可能成为高级别的簇头。簇头间的通信方式结合了单跳和多跳,使得能量消耗更为均衡。 LEACH-RMC的一个显著特点是采用固定簇头,这意味着不是所有节点都需要具备成为簇头的硬件能力,从而降低了普通节点的硬件成本。通过这种方式,算法成功地延长了网络的生存期,同时也平衡了簇头的负载,避免了因簇头过早死亡而导致的网络瘫痪。 实验结果表明,LEACH-RMC相对于LEACH有明显的性能提升。在对比图中,LEACH-RMC在每个轮次的能耗都低于LEACH,这证实了新算法在节能方面的优越性。然而,尽管LEACH-RMC在初期表现出色,但随着网络运行时间的增长,可能需要进一步优化以维持长期的性能优势。 无线传感网的路由策略必须考虑节点的能量效率和网络的生存时间。LEACH-RMC算法为解决这个问题提供了一个有效的解决方案,特别是在异构网络环境中,它展示了如何通过创新的簇头选择和通信方式来优化能量消耗。未来的研究可能会在此基础上进一步探索动态调整策略,以适应网络条件的变化,以及如何更好地利用节点的剩余能量,实现网络生命周期的最大化。